WebOct 3, 2024 · The noun weather derived from a word meaning air and sky. The state of almost anything related to the air and sky is weather—temperature, windiness, moisture, etc. As a verb, weather means to endure or to be exposed to and affected by weather. Webhoi pol· loi ˌhȯi-pə-ˈlȯi Synonyms of hoi polloi 1 : the general populace : masses 2 : people of distinction or wealth or elevated social status : elite Usage and Meanings of Hoi Polloi Since hoi polloi is a transliteration of the Greek for "the many," some critics have asserted that the phrase should not be preceded by the. Weba (1) : the casting or recording of the votes of a body of persons. (2) : a counting of votes cast. b. : the place where votes are cast or recorded usually used in plural. at the polls. c. : the period of time during which votes may be cast at an election.
